A European localisation prototype of Pokémon Gold & Silver, dated December 15, 2000. This build is available compiled for the German and French languages. This build, considering its "final" labelling, would appear to have been sent to Nintendo Lotcheck. However, as the released version of French Pokémon Gold & Silver is lotcheck version 0.2, and German Gold & Silver version 0.3, it is likely that this build failed lotcheck due to bugs or other issues that contravened Nintendo's software approval process.
